This might not seem like much to some people, but it is a HUGE success for me. I've always been an over eater. It started when I was a kid and my mom would make me sit at the table until every bite was gone. Maybe that's an excuse, maybe not. I hate leaving empty places on my plate, it has to be FULL of food. And I cannot NOT finish my plate. I have to eat every bite or I have this tremendous guilt. And on top of all that food negativity, I am a "bored" snacker. I can sit on the couch with a bag of chips in my lap and eat the ENTIRE bag. I will tell myself "You're not hungry" "You're full now" "You're going to make yourself sick" and still I keep eating.

Well, today I didn't.

Today I opened a bag of jelly beans (for my daughter's potty training rewards) and I ate a couple. Just a couple, not the whole bag. I made popcorn for an after school snack, and didn't eat any. I had half a sandwich for lunch and put the rest away. I didn't eat seconds for dinner. And when my kids didn't finish their plates, *I* didn't finish their plates either. And guess who's eating an orange for dessert? Me.

I'm so proud of myself I could cry. I might only be down 7 lbs, but I feel a hundred pounds lighter right now.
